The image features a minimalist landscape with a simple sketching technique. The perspective shows a panoramic view of the landscape with the horizon slightly above the middle. A house is seen on the horizon to the right, and a road or path leads towards it from the left. Tall trees are sketched with light strokes in the foreground. The brushstrokes are loose, giving an impressionistic feel. The color palette is monochromatic with various shades of black and grey on a light background.
